How much do lead software engineer jobs pay per year?

As of May 28, 2026, the average yearly pay for lead software engineer in New York, NY is $160,026.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$132,700.00 and $184,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Lead Software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Lead Software Engineer, you need advanced programming expertise, software architecture knowledge, and a degree in computer science or a related field, often supplemented by experience in leading development teams. Familiarity with version control systems (like Git), cloud platforms (such as AWS or Azure), and methodologies like Agile or Scrum is typically expected. Exceptional communication, leadership, and problem-solving abilities are crucial soft skills for mentoring developers and managing projects. These skills ensure efficient project delivery, high-quality code, and effective team collaboration in complex technical environments.

How does a Lead Software Engineer typically balance hands-on coding with leadership and mentoring responsibilities?

As a Lead Software Engineer, you'll find that your role involves a dynamic mix of technical work and team leadership. While you'll still contribute directly to codebases—often tackling complex or critical components—you'll also spend significant time guiding junior engineers, conducting code reviews, and facilitating technical discussions. Balancing these responsibilities requires strong time management and communication skills, as well as the ability to delegate effectively. The role offers the opportunity to shape technical direction while fostering team growth and collaboration.

What are Lead Software Engineers?

Lead Software Engineers are senior-level professionals responsible for overseeing software development teams and guiding the technical direction of projects. They combine strong programming skills with leadership abilities, ensuring that software solutions are designed, developed, and maintained according to best practices and business requirements. Lead Software Engineers mentor junior team members, coordinate tasks, and often collaborate with other departments to deliver high-quality products on time. Their role is crucial in bridging the gap between technical teams and management, ensuring both technical excellence and alignment with organizational goals.

Job description

Technical Lead/Lead Software Engineer

We are seeking a highly motivated Technical Lead/Lead Software Engineer to join our team. In this role, you will be a part of shaping Guardian's most critical customer-facing digital experiences, utilizing various frameworks such as React, Next and Node. This position requires technical familiarity with building scalable, performant web applications in AWS, working collaboratively with a team of engineers, collaborating with business leaders, UI/UX, data and leadership to create best-in-class experiences for our customers.

What you will get to do:

  • Be Creative - have the freedom to innovate, modernize and create technical solutions to solve complex business problems
  • Be Collaborative - work with product and design to deliver robust user experiences.
  • Be Precise - understand the business goals behind every feature and create a solution that can deliver
  • Be Awesome - launch products that you can be proud of

What you bring to the table:

  • 10+ years of experience delivering resilient, highly performant, public-facing web applications that have had demonstrative business impact.
  • Highly proficient in Javascript/Typescript (Node/React/Next/NestJS/Jest), including advanced patterns to architect large applications, build strategies to maintain these apps in good standards and mentor the team in the appropriate standards.
  • Extensive experience in API development best practices (REST/GraphQL) and integration with third-party systems.
  • Experience with Redis, micro-frontends and micro-services desirable.
  • Mastery of web fundamentals, including vanilla Javascript, HTML, CSS, and web core vitals performance management.
  • Experience developing complex applications in an Agile environment as part of a team of engineers, designers, product experts, marketers, and strategists
  • Experience with modern web application development, including building tools, testing, CI/CD and AWS.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
  • Working knowledge of security best practices, e.g.: OWASP, dealing with PII data.
  • Excitement, energy, and strong people skills including excellent written and verbal communication.
  • BA/BS degree in computer science or relevant history
